I'm watching like a tint hawk a job outside my factory I did about 5 years ago easy for one of my factory neighbours. It gets no shade and bakes 12 hours a day in the sun and it was JWF's SP 35.

It is no doubt colour changed...that's definate and can't be colour matched now but no signs of fuzziness or "going off" so far. That's bloody reasonable to give credit where it is due. :thumb
